Ag Data Transparent

A set of privacy and security principles for companies collecting, storing, analyzing, and using, farmer data. “Core Principles” serve as basic guidelines that ag tech providers should follow when collecting, using, storing, and transferring farmers’ ag data. Includes Ag Data Transparent certification.

Data Ethics Framework Guidance

The Data Ethics Framework guides the design of appropriate data use in government and the wider public sector. This guidance is aimed at anyone working directly or indirectly with data in the public sector, including data practitioners (statisticians, analysts and data scientists), policymakers, operational staff and those helping produce data-informed insight. Includes a workbook to help your team record the ethical decisions you’ve made about your project.

Guide to Personal Data Protection and Privacy

Principles and operational standards for the protection of beneficiaries’ personal data in WFP’s programming. These Guidelines have been developed for all WFP personnel involved in the processing of data concerning actual or potential beneficiaries. They cover data protection principles and the application of those principles. They also provide instructions on how to conduct a Privacy Impact Assessment, and include tools for use at HQ and in the field.

Guidance on the Protection of Personal Data of Persons of Concern to UNHCR

The purpose of this Guidance on the Protection of Personal Data of Persons of Concern is to assist UNHCR personnel in the application and interpretation of the Policy on the Protection of Personal Data of Persons of Concern (DPP), adopted in May 2015. It promotes
the principled and practical implementation across all UNHCR operations.

Policy on the Protection of Personal Data of Persons of Concern to UNHCR

This Policy lays down the rules and principles relating to the processing of personal data of persons of concern to UNHCR. Its purpose is to ensure that UNHCR processes personal data in a way that is consistent with the 1990 United Nations General Assembly’s Guidelines for the Regulation of Computerized Personal Data Files and other international instruments concerning the protection of personal data and individuals’ privacy.
